--- Comment #1 from Gleb Popov <arrowd@FreeBSD.org> ---
We don't provide GHC 8.0.2 from ports, and there is no working distribution to
be used by stack. On the other side, wstunnel doesn't build with recent LTS
snapshots.

So, there is nothing that can be done on our side. Why do you need
-optl-static, anyways? Stack links statically by default.

Bug upstream to update their application to more recent LTS snapshot.
